Aerodrome Finance is a next-generation AMM serving as the central liquidity hub of Base. It integrates a robust liquidity incentive engine, a vote-lock governance model, and a user-friendly interface, inheriting the advanced features of Velodrome V2.
Read more on AERO →YieldBasis is a DeFi protocol built on Curve Finance that enables users to earn yield on assets like Bitcoin while minimizing impermanent loss. It uses a constant 2× compounding leverage model to help LP positions track the underlying asset price 1:1. The YB token supports governance through a vote-escrowed (veYB) model and allows holders to share in protocol revenue.
